GOODLINE® PU-11 AS
TU 20.30.22-072-12288779-2017
POLYURETHANE COMPOSITION
FOR ANTISTATIC
SELF-LEVELING FLOOR
Self-levelling double-packed polyurethane composition, does not contain thinners.
Recommended use
For polymeric flooring with antistatic properties for concrete bases. It is used in explosion- and fire-hazardous industries, as well as in rooms where protection of electronic equipment and personnel from static electricity is necessary.
Technical specifications:
coating appearance -homogeneous, gloss, of respective color with inclusions of current-conducting agents
coating color- primary colors are gray, light-gray (some black-colored inclusions – antistatic agents, are allowed). Other colors are according to color chart of the manufacturing company
Theoretical consumption per one-layer coating of 1 mm thick, kg/m2-1,4 (actual consumption depends on extent of the base evenness and designed thickness of coating)
Recommended thickness of one layer, mm 1,5 - 2,0
Physical and mechanical characteristics of the coating:
adhesion to concrete (GOST 28574) 2,4 MPa, not less than (pull-off from concrete)
tensile strength (ISO 527-2) 8 MPa, not less than
tear (peel) resistance (ISO 34-1) 50 N/mm2 , not less than
elongation at break (ISO 527-3) 80 %, not less than
tear (peel) resistance (ISO 34-1) 50 N/mm2 , not less than
wearabality (GOST 11529) 1 µm, not more than
taber wearability at load 1000 g (Calibrade CS10) 60 mg, not more than
electric resistance 1·104 - 1·106 Ohm
Application conditions:
room temperature - from +8 °C to +35 °C;
relative humidity - up to 80%.
Hardening time
weak pedestrian load-in 48 hours.;
intensive pedestrian load– 7 days
full load (including moving of vehicles with rubber tires) – 14 days.
Storage conditions:
Storage and transportation of the base and hardener of the composition – at a temperature from +5 ° C to +30 ° C, in accordance with GOST 9980.5 in a hermetically sealed container of the manufacturer far from heat sources. During storage and transportation, the packaging should not be exposed to atmospheric precipitation and direct sunlight.
